Searched refs:LiveRegDefs (Results 1 - 2 of 2) sorted by relevance

/external/llvm/lib/CodeGen/SelectionDAG/
H A DScheduleDAGFast.cpp72 /// LiveRegDefs - A set of physical registers and their definition
76 std::vector<SUnit*> LiveRegDefs; member in class:__anon21212::ScheduleDAGFast
120 LiveRegDefs.resize(TRI->getNumRegs(), NULL);
170 if (!LiveRegDefs[I->getReg()]) {
172 LiveRegDefs[I->getReg()] = I->getSUnit();
198 assert(LiveRegDefs[I->getReg()] == SU &&
201 LiveRegDefs[I->getReg()] = NULL;
449 std::vector<SUnit*> &LiveRegDefs,
455 if (LiveRegDefs[*AI] && LiveRegDefs[*A
448 CheckForLiveRegDef(SUnit *SU, unsigned Reg, std::vector<SUnit*> &LiveRegDefs, SmallSet<unsigned, 4> &RegAdded, SmallVectorImpl<unsigned> &LRegs, const TargetRegisterInfo *TRI) argument
[all...]
H A DScheduleDAGRRList.cpp139 /// LiveRegDefs - A set of physical registers and their definition
143 std::vector<SUnit*> LiveRegDefs; member in class:__anon21215::ScheduleDAGRRList
330 LiveRegDefs.resize(TRI->getNumRegs() + 1, NULL);
508 /// Always update LiveRegDefs for a register dependence even if the current SU
519 /// LiveRegDefs[flags] = 3
534 SUnit *RegDef = LiveRegDefs[I->getReg()]; (void)RegDef;
537 LiveRegDefs[I->getReg()] = I->getSUnit();
549 if (!LiveRegDefs[CallResource])
561 LiveRegDefs[CallResource] = Def;
742 if (I->isAssignedRegDep() && LiveRegDefs[
1205 CheckForLiveRegDef(SUnit *SU, unsigned Reg, std::vector<SUnit*> &LiveRegDefs, SmallSet<unsigned, 4> &RegAdded, SmallVectorImpl<unsigned> &LRegs, const TargetRegisterInfo *TRI) argument
1227 CheckForLiveRegDefMasked(SUnit *SU, const uint32_t *RegMask, std::vector<SUnit*> &LiveRegDefs, SmallSet<unsigned, 4> &RegAdded, SmallVectorImpl<unsigned> &LRegs) argument
[all...]

Completed in 27 milliseconds